Hawaii Five-O is splashing into The Day Shift lineup! Starting January 21, the series will air every Friday at 12P | 11C for five full hours of classic Jack Lord action.

Giving birth to the catchphrase "Book 'em, Danno," Hawaii Five-O follows Detective Steve McGarrett and his elite police unit as he and his officers investigate corruption and crime plaguing the Hawaiian Islands. For 12 seasons, McGarrett and his team battled international secret agents, criminals, and organized crime syndicates, drawing themselves into the world of international espionage and national intelligence.

Being one of the longest-running police dramas of its time, the acclaimed series created many of the classic crime show staples that we still see today.
